The Core Mechanics: Step‑by‑Step Control

Betting Phase

You start by selecting a bet amount and difficulty level—each step forward brings you closer to a higher multiplier but also increases risk.

Crossing Phase

The chicken moves across twenty‑four tiles (easy) to fifteen tiles (hardcore). Behind each tile lies either safe ground or a hidden trap.

Decision Phase

After every successful step you decide: stay and hope for another boost or cash out now to lock in your winnings.

Resolution Phase

If you cash out before a trap appears, your bet is multiplied by the current factor; if a trap catches the chicken, you lose the entire stake.

This cycle repeats instantly—making each round a micro‑tournament of risk versus reward.

Choosing the Right Difficulty for Fast Wins

The game offers four difficulty levels that affect both the number of steps and the probability of hitting a trap:

  • Easy (24 steps): Low risk, modest multipliers—ideal for beginners looking for frequent small wins.
  • Medium (22 steps): Balanced risk and reward—suitable for players who want a bit more thrill without extreme volatility.
  • Hard (20 steps): Higher risk with greater potential payouts—best for those comfortable with faster crash points.
  • Hardcore (15 steps): Maximum risk; traps appear every 10–25% of steps—reserved for experienced players chasing big multipliers.

For short sessions where you want to hit wins quickly, start on Easy or Medium and move up only if you’re confident in your timing and bankroll management.

Managing Bankroll on the Fly

A short‑session player never has time to chase losses over long stretches. Keep your stake small relative to your bankroll—typically 1–3% per round—to maintain a buffer for inevitable downswings.

Set an absolute loss limit before you start a session; stop playing once that threshold is reached regardless of how many wins have come your way.
